Role overview
We are seeking people who are enthusiastic, willing to learn and develop their understanding of a career in Business Services. Our Team has an excellent reputation for providing a variety of accounting services to clients, including bookkeeping, payroll, VAT returns and management accounts.
We are looking for someone who is ideally coming from a payroll bureau background, however we are open to providing this opportunity to candidates from various backgrounds who have great communication skills, are enthusiastic, willing to learn and undergo training.
Key Responsibilities
- Providing a payroll service to clients on a weekly, fortnightly, and monthly basis.
- Uploading payslips and other information to Sage online documents.
- Processing employee information and preparing payslips.
- Creating, evaluating, and submitting reports to clients.
- Reporting to HMRC on various issues.
- Uploading pensions to the relevant pension provider each pay period.
- Providing advice and guidance on the more complex aspects of payroll, pay and benefits to clients.
- Advising clients of and PAYE liability due to HMRC.
- Applying, deducting, and advising clients of any Earnings Arrestment’s deducted.
- Reporting to HMRC each pay period by the required deadline dates.
- Reporting and recoverable statutory payments and Apprenticeship Levy to HMRC.
- Manual Calculations on all elements (Tax, NIC, Director NIC, Student Loan, Earnings Arrestment’s & Pensions).
- We are an approved BACS Bureau – we are responsible for making salary & PAYE payments on behalf of our clients each month, by the required dates.
- CIS – Preparation and submission of monthly CIS Returns and CIS Suffered submissions to HMRC.
- Building effective and long-term working relationships with each of your clients.
